Commit 637c30fb authored by steurwadkar's avatar steurwadkar

F17ABAS001 GST API calling web part commit


git-svn-id: http://15.206.35.175/svn/proteus/business-java/trunk@106191 ce508802-f39f-4f6c-b175-0d175dae99d5
parent dc7f004f
......@@ -386,7 +386,10 @@ function generateOTP()
var userName = document.getElementById("Detail1.1.username").value.trim();
var stateCode = document.getElementById("Detail1.1.state_code").value.trim();
var gstinNo = document.getElementById("Detail1.1.gstin").value.trim();
var url = "/ibase/GSTDataSubmitWizServlet?action=GENERATE_OTP&user_name="+escape(userName)+"&state_code="+stateCode+"&gstin_no="+escape(gstinNo)+"";
var periodCode = document.getElementById("Detail1.1.period_code").value.trim();
var siteCode = document.getElementById("Detail1.1.site_code").value.trim();
var recType = document.getElementById("Detail1.1.returns_type").value.trim();
var url = "/ibase/GSTDataSubmitWizServlet?action=GENERATE_OTP&user_name="+escape(userName)+"&state_code="+stateCode+"&gstin_no="+escape(gstinNo)+"&period_code="+escape(periodCode)+"&site_code="+escape(siteCode)+"&rec_type="+escape(recType)+"";
makeRequest( url, OTPGenerated);
}
......
......@@ -134,7 +134,7 @@
<div class="eachField">
<div class="inputDiv"><input type="text" class="editDisplayClass" value="{$state_descr}" name="Detail1.{normalize-space($dbID)}.state_descr" id="Detail1.{normalize-space($dbID)}.state_descr" tabIndex="-1" readOnly="true" style="width:150px;"/></div>
</div>
<div class="eachField" style="float:right;">
<div class="eachField" style="float:right;display:none;">
<div class="labelDiv">Gross turnover<span style="color:red;">*</span> : </div>
<div class="inputDiv"><input type="text" class="input_editable" value="{$gross_turnover}" name="Detail1.{normalize-space($dbID)}.gross_turnover" id="Detail1.{normalize-space($dbID)}.gross_turnover" tabIndex="30" style="text-align:right;padding-right:4px;width:120px;" onblur="checkValidInput(this);" onkeypress="return isNumberKey(event);"/></div>
</div>
......@@ -193,7 +193,7 @@
<input type="hidden" value="1" name="FORM_NO" ID="FORM_NO" />
<input type="hidden" value="gstsalesdata_file" name="OBJ_NAME" />
<input type="hidden" value="" name="action" id="action" />
<input type="submit" style="cursor:hand;margin-left:20px;" value="Finish" onclick="setActionVal('finish');return validateHeaderForm();displayWaitImg();" class="button" title='Finish' id="finish"/>
<input type="submit" style="cursor:hand;margin-left:20px;" value="Next" onclick="setActionVal('next');return validateHeaderForm();" class="button" title='Next' id="next"/>
</div>
</div>
<div id="buttonreplacement">
......
......@@ -113,6 +113,7 @@
<xsl:variable name="app_key"><xsl:value-of select="app_key"/></xsl:variable>
<xsl:variable name="returns_type"><xsl:value-of select="returns_type"/></xsl:variable>
<xsl:variable name="gross_turnover"><xsl:value-of select="gross_turnover"/></xsl:variable>
<xsl:variable name="cur_gross_turnover"><xsl:value-of select="cur_gross_turnover"/></xsl:variable>
<xsl:variable name="action"><xsl:value-of select="action"/></xsl:variable>
<div class="inputFormDiv">
......@@ -134,9 +135,15 @@
<div class="eachField">
<div class="inputDiv"><input type="text" class="editDisplayClass" value="{$state_descr}" name="Detail1.{normalize-space($dbID)}.state_descr" id="Detail1.{normalize-space($dbID)}.state_descr" tabIndex="-1" readOnly="true" style="width:150px;"/></div>
</div>
<div class="eachField" style="float:right;">
</div>
<div class="eachLineFields" style="width:675px;">
<div class="eachField">
<div class="labelDiv">Gross turnover<span style="color:red;">*</span> : </div>
<div class="inputDiv"><input type="text" class="input_editable" value="{$gross_turnover}" name="Detail1.{normalize-space($dbID)}.gross_turnover" id="Detail1.{normalize-space($dbID)}.gross_turnover" tabIndex="30" style="text-align:right;padding-right:4px;width:120px;" onblur="checkValidInput(this);" onkeypress="return isNumberKey(event);"/></div>
<div class="inputDiv"><input type="text" class="editDisplayClass" value="{$gross_turnover}" name="Detail1.{normalize-space($dbID)}.gross_turnover" id="Detail1.{normalize-space($dbID)}.gross_turnover" tabIndex="-1" readOnly="true" style="text-align:right;padding-right:4px;width:120px;" onblur="checkValidInput(this);" onkeypress="return isNumberKey(event);"/></div>
</div>
<div class="eachField" style="float:right;">
<div class="labelDiv" style="width:250px;">Current year Gross turnover<span style="color:red;">*</span> : </div>
<div class="inputDiv"><input type="text" class="editDisplayClass" value="{$cur_gross_turnover}" name="Detail1.{normalize-space($dbID)}.cur_gross_turnover" id="Detail1.{normalize-space($dbID)}.cur_gross_turnover" tabIndex="-1" readOnly="true" style="text-align:right;padding-right:4px;width:120px;" onblur="checkValidInput(this);" onkeypress="return isNumberKey(event);"/></div>
</div>
</div>
<div class="eachLineFields">
......
......@@ -132,7 +132,7 @@
<div class="eachField">
<div class="inputDiv"><input type="text" class="editDisplayClass" value="{$state_descr}" name="Detail1.{normalize-space($dbID)}.state_descr" id="Detail1.{normalize-space($dbID)}.state_descr" tabIndex="-1" readOnly="true" style="width:150px;"/></div>
</div>
<div class="eachField" style="float:right;">
<div class="eachField" style="float:right;display:none;">
<div class="labelDiv">Gross turnover<span style="color:red;">*</span> : </div>
<div class="inputDiv"><input type="text" class="input_editable" value="{$gross_turnover}" name="Detail1.{normalize-space($dbID)}.gross_turnover" id="Detail1.{normalize-space($dbID)}.gross_turnover" tabIndex="30" style="text-align:right;padding-right:4px;width:120px;" onblur="checkValidInput(this);" onkeypress="return isNumberKey(event);"/></div>
</div>
......
......@@ -566,6 +566,48 @@
</xsl:for-each>
</div>
</xsl:for-each>
<xsl:for-each select="cdnur_data">
<button class="accordion1" type="button" expanded="false">
<div class="iconDiv">C</div>
<div class="invTypDiv">Credit/Debit note unregistered</div>
</button>
<div class="panel1">
<xsl:for-each select="cdnur">
<button class="accordion2" type="button" expanded="false">
<p style="font-size:15px;margin:0px;">Credit/Debit note number - <xsl:value-of select="nt_num"/>, Date - <xsl:value-of select="nt_dt"/>, Amount - <xsl:value-of select="val"/></p>
<p style="margin:0px;">Reference invoice number - <xsl:value-of select="inum"/>, Date - <xsl:value-of select="idt"/></p>
</button>
<div class="panel2">
<table class="tableClass">
<thead class="table-head">
<tr>
<th nowrap="true" style="border-left:0px solid black !important;" align="right">Serial #</th>
<th nowrap="true" align="right">Taxable amount</th>
<th nowrap="true" align="right">Rate</th>
<th nowrap="true" align="right">IGST amount</th>
<th nowrap="true" align="right">CGST amount</th>
<th nowrap="true" align="right">SGST amount</th>
<th nowrap="true" style="border-right:0px solid black !important;" align="right">Cess amount</th>
</tr>
</thead>
<tbody class="table-body">
<xsl:for-each select="itms">
<tr class='trClass'>
<td class="td_rightAlign" style="border-left:0px solid black !important;"><xsl:value-of select="num"/></td>
<td class="td_rightAlign"><xsl:value-of select="itm_det/txval"/></td>
<td class="td_rightAlign"><xsl:value-of select="itm_det/rt"/></td>
<td class="td_rightAlign"><xsl:value-of select="itm_det/iamt"/></td>
<td class="td_rightAlign"><xsl:value-of select="itm_det/camt"/></td>
<td class="td_rightAlign"><xsl:value-of select="itm_det/samt"/></td>
<td class="td_rightAlign" style="border-right:0px solid black !important;"><xsl:value-of select="itm_det/csamt"/></td>
</tr>
</xsl:for-each>
</tbody>
</table>
</div>
</xsl:for-each>
</div>
</xsl:for-each>
<xsl:for-each select="at_data">
<button class="accordion1" type="button" expanded="false">
<div class="iconDiv">A</div>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ment